New pocket-sized sensor to detect asthma, lung damage causing sulphur dioxide

New Delhi, July 4: Scientists from the Centre for Nano and Soft Matter Sciences (CeNS), Bengaluru, have developed a new low-cost sensor that can help detect toxic sulphur dioxide (SO2) gas responsible for respiratory irritation, asthma attacks, and long-term lung damage, at extremely low concentrations, said the Ministry of Science and Technology on Friday. CUET-UG 2025 result out: One student scores 100 percentile in 4 subjects

One student scored 100 percentile in four subjects, and 17 got 100 percentile in three subjects in the CUET-UG 2025 - Common University Entrance Test (Undergraduate) - result for which was declared by the National Testing Agency (NTA) on Friday, said an official.

RBI announces zero charges on prepaying loans before time

The Reserve Bank of India (RBI) has given relief to loan takers. Actually, RBI has decided to abolish the pre-payment charge on loans with floating interest rates.

Delhi Police bust mobile phone theft syndicate, recover 43 stolen iPhones

Delhi Police recently busted a gang of mobile phone thieves and 'traders', recovering as many as 44 premium phones, of which 43 were stolen iPhones, an official said.

2 IAF personnel drown in lake as heavy rains pound Uttarakhand

Uttarakhand: Amidst heavy rainfall in Uttarakhand, two Indian Air Force personnel drowned in a swollen lake in Bhimtal, officials reported on Friday. Prince Yadav from Pathankot, Punjab, and Sahil Kumar from Muzaffarpur, Bihar, were part of a group of eight IAF personnel, including four women, on vacation in Nainital, according to Circle Officer Pramod Shah..

Lilavati Trust Case: SC Refuses to Quash FIR Against HDFC Bank CEO in ₹2.05 Cr Bribery Case

New Delhi, July 4: The Supreme Court on Friday declined to entertain a plea of HDFC Bank CEO and Managing Director Sashidhar Jagdishan to quash an FIR lodged against him, following a complaint by the Lilavati Kirtilal Mehta Medical Trust, which runs Mumbai’s Lilavati Hospital, that he has accepted a bribe of Rs 2.05 crore..
